WPC (Wood-Plastic Composite) wood grain board is an innovative material made from a combination of wood fibers and plastic polymers. Typically, the composition consists of:
50-70% wood fibers (such as sawdust, bamboo, or rice husk)
30-50% plastic polymers (such as polyethylene (PE), polypropylene (PP), or polyvinyl chloride (PVC))
Additives (such as UV stabilizers, color pigments, and bonding agents)
The manufacturing process involves:
Mixing raw materials – Wood fibers, plastic resins, and additives are blended together.
Extrusion or molding – The mixture is heated and shaped into boards using high-pressure extrusion.
Surface finishing – The boards are embossed with wood grain patterns for a natural appearance.
Cooling and cutting – The boards are cooled and cut into desired lengths.

To determine whether WPC wood grain boards are suitable for outdoor applications, we need to analyze their performance in different environmental conditions.
WPC wood grain boards are highly resistant to extreme weather conditions such as rain, sun exposure, and temperature fluctuations.
Unlike natural wood, they do not expand, contract, or crack due to moisture absorption.
Traditional wood absorbs water, causing swelling and rotting.
In contrast, WPC wood grain boards have a water absorption rate of less than 1%, making them ideal for humid and rainy environments.
Natural wood tends to fade and deteriorate under prolonged sun exposure.
WPC wood grain boards are treated with UV stabilizers, preventing discoloration and surface damage.

Some WPC wood grain boards can retain heat, especially in direct sunlight.
Choosing light-colored boards or co-extruded WPC decking can reduce heat absorption.
WPC wood grain boards provide better traction than wet wooden surfaces.
Many WPC decking boards have anti-slip coatings, making them safe for outdoor use.
